Lighting needs addressed

Dear Editor: Who is responsible for the lights on the highway leading onto the Ohio/West Virginia bridge? Who is responsible for the lights that line the road leading into East Liverpool coming from the East End? Could this have been a factor in the accident where a truck hit the split abutment and flipped into the river? It is a dangerous situation that has been ongoing for too long! A thick fog really intensifies the danger. Betty Sayers Chester
